- Rumors of a variable-aperture main camera for Apple's upcoming iPhone 18 Pro series have been circulating for some time.
- Tipster Ice Universe now claims that Apple could reserve the feature for the Pro Max model.
- According to the tipster, the variable-aperture camera hardware requires additional space, which the larger Pro Max model can accommodate.
- Notably, the tipster previously claimed that the iPhone 18 Pro Max will weigh 240g and measure 9mm in thickness, making it slightly heavier and thicker than the current model.
- This would not be the first time Apple has reserved camera hardware for the Pro Max model.
